1 ORDINANCE NO. 20,728
2
3 AN ORDINANCE TO CONDEMN CERTAIN STRUCTURES IN THE
4 CITY OF LITTLE ROCK AS STRUCTURAL, FIRE AND HEALTH
5 HAZARDS; TO PROVIDE FOR SUMMARY ABATEMENT
6 PROCEDURES; TO DIRECT THE CITY STAFF TO TAKE SUCH
7 ACTION AS IS NECESSARY TO RAZE AND REMOVE SAID
8 STRUCTURES; TO DECLARE AN EMERGENCY; AND FOR OTHER
9 PURPOSES.
10
11 WHEREAS,certain structures in the City of Little Rock, Arkansas, identified in this ordinance have
12 become run-down, dilapidated, unsightly, dangerous, obnoxious and detrimental to the public welfare of
13 the citizens of Little Rock; and
14 WHEREAS, the condition of the structures has deteriorated to the point that they are dangerous to
15 the health and safety of the occupants or other persons and, further, are in such condition as to be
• 16 dangerous to the lives, limbs and property of people in its vicinity or those lawfully passing thereby; and
17 WHEREAS, the condition of these structures constitutes a serious structural, fire and health hazard;
18 and
19 WHEREAS, the owners of the structures have received proper legal notice to either rehabilitate or
20 remove the structures and have failed to do so; and
21 WHEREAS; such structures are hereby declared a nuisance and immediate action is necessary to
22 demolish the structures.
23 NOW,TH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E BOARD OF DIRECTORS OF THE CITY
24 OF LITTLE ROCK,ARKANSAS:
25 Section 1. The conditions of the structures located on the properties described below have been
26 found to present structural, fire and health hazards and are dangerous to the health and safety of the
27 occupants or other persons, and further, the structures are in such condition as to be dangerous to the
28 lives, limbs and property of people in the vicinity or those lawfully passing thereby. The Board of
29 Directors hereby condemns the following structures, identified by street address, legal description and
30 owner, and declares them to be public nuisances:

39 Section 2. The City Manager is hereby authorized to direct the Housing and Neighborhood Programs
40 Department to raze and remove the structures condemned in this ordinance and to file and enforce a lien
41 against the properties described herein for the cost of razing and removing said structures pursuant to
42 Little Rock, Ark., Rev. Code ("LRC") §20-29(1988).
43 Section 3. Severability. In the event any section, subsection, subdivision, paragraph,
44 subparagraph, item, sentence, clause, phrase, or word of this ordinance is declared or adjudged to
45 be invalid or unconstitutional, such declaration or adjudication shall not affect the remaining
[Page 2 of 31
•
1 provisions of this ordinance, as if such invalid or unconstitutional provision was not originally a
2 part of this ordinance.
3 Section 4. Repealer. All ordinances, resolutions, bylaws, and other matters inconsistent with
4 this ordinance are hereby repealed to the extent of such inconsistency.
5 Section 5. Emergency Clause. Unless the provisions of this ordinance are put into effect
6 immediately,the public health, safety and welfare of the citizens of Little Rock will be adversely affected;
7 therefore, an emergency is hereby declared to exist, and this ordinance shall be in full force and effect
8 from and after its passage.
